About me
I have 15 years of experience as a licensed mental health counselor in Indiana and over 20 years of experience in the mental health field. I have worked with children, teens, adults, and families on various issues including anxiety, depression, anger management, self-esteem, adjustment, trauma, substance use, interpersonal relationships, and life stressors. I have also helped clients to address self-harm behaviors and grief and loss.
My therapy style is collaborative and person centered. I use a combination of therapeutic approaches including cognitive behavioral therapy, solution focused therapy, and person centered therapy. I believe that all individuals must be treated with respect and empathy. I commit to providing individuals with a safe space to discuss sensitive and difficult problems and to be non-judgmental.
Therapy can be hard and uncomfortable but a very rewarding experience and one you will learn from and value forever. It takes patience and courage to seek help. I commit to support and empower you to make the changes you are planning to make. I look forward to working with you!
